Fast and Specialized Webb8 sep. 2024 · PRP prepared and administered for clinical purposes is the delivery of autologous human plasma-containing platelets and associated growth factors at supra-physiologic levels [2, 3]. Blood is drawn from a peripheral vein and centrifuged to separate the whole blood components into layers.
